XML 144 R97.htm IDEA: XBRL DOCUMENT v3.6.0.2
Retirement Benefits (Narrative) (Details)
$ in Millions
12 Months Ended
Dec. 31, 2016
USD ($)
item
Dec. 31, 2015
USD ($)
item
Dec. 31, 2014
USD ($)
item
Defined Benefit Plan Disclosure [Line Items]      
Postretirement benefits contributions $ 108 $ 262 $ 32
Union employees percentage 39.00%    
Consumers Energy Company [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Postretirement benefits contributions $ 98 243 29
Union employees percentage 41.00%    
DB Pension Plan [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Trust assets $ 2,101 $ 2,013 $ 1,979
Estimated time of amortization of gains losses 10 years 10 years 10 years
Period for gains or losses to be included in market related value 5 years    
Postretirement benefits contributions $ 100 $ 225  
DB Pension Plan [Member] | Consumers Energy Company [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Estimated time of amortization of gains losses 10 years 10 years 10 years
Period for gains or losses to be included in market related value 5 years    
Postretirement benefits contributions $ 93 $ 209  
OPEB [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Trust assets $ 1,264 $ 1,208 $ 1,265
Retirement age requirement | item 55 55 55
Retirement years of service 10 years    
Retirement years of service with disability 15 years    
Ultimate health care cost trend rate 4.75%    
Year that rate reaches ultimate trend rate 2027    
Estimated time of amortization of gains losses 11 years 13 years 13 years
Estimated time of prior service cost   10 years  
Postretirement benefits contributions   $ 29 $ 25
OPEB [Member] | Consumers Energy Company [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Trust assets $ 1,184 $ 1,133 $ 1,186
Retirement age requirement | item 55 55 55
Retirement years of service 10 years    
Retirement years of service with disability 15 years    
Ultimate health care cost trend rate 4.75%    
Year that rate reaches ultimate trend rate 2027    
Estimated time of amortization of gains losses 11 years 13 years 13 years
Estimated time of prior service cost   10 years  
Postretirement benefits contributions   $ 29 $ 25
Pension And OPEB [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Amortized net gains and losses in excess of PBO or MRV 10.00% 10.00% 10.00%
Pension And OPEB [Member] | Consumers Energy Company [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Amortized net gains and losses in excess of PBO or MRV 10.00% 10.00% 10.00%
Defined Company Contribution Plan [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Plan cost, defined contribution plan $ 20 $ 16 $ 13
Defined Company Contribution Plan [Member] | Consumers Energy Company [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Plan cost, defined contribution plan $ 19 16 13
DC SERP [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Minimum years of participation before vesting 5 years    
Trust assets $ 3 2  
DC SERP [Member] | Consumers Energy Company [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Minimum years of participation before vesting 5 years    
Trust assets $ 3 2  
401 (K) Plan [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Plan cost, defined contribution plan $ 24 19 18
Employer match of eligible contributions 100.00%    
Employer match of eligible wages 3.00%    
Secondary employer match of eligible contributions 50.00%    
Secondary employer match of eligible wages 2.00%    
401 (K) Plan [Member] | Consumers Energy Company [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Plan cost, defined contribution plan $ 23 19 18
Employer match of eligible contributions 100.00%    
Employer match of eligible wages 3.00%    
Secondary employer match of eligible contributions 50.00%    
Secondary employer match of eligible wages 2.00%    
Minimum [Member] | Defined Company Contribution Plan [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Employer match of eligible wages 5.00%    
Minimum [Member] | Defined Company Contribution Plan [Member] | Consumers Energy Company [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Employer match of eligible wages 5.00%    
Minimum [Member] | DC SERP [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Plan contribution percentage 5.00%    
Minimum [Member] | DC SERP [Member] | Consumers Energy Company [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Plan contribution percentage 5.00%    
Maximum [Member] | Defined Company Contribution Plan [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Employer match of eligible wages 7.00%    
Maximum [Member] | Defined Company Contribution Plan [Member] | Consumers Energy Company [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Employer match of eligible wages 7.00%    
Maximum [Member] | DC SERP [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Plan cost, defined contribution plan $ 1 1 1
Plan contribution percentage 15.00%    
Maximum [Member] | DC SERP [Member] | Consumers Energy Company [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Plan cost, defined contribution plan $ 1 $ 1 $ 1
Plan contribution percentage 15.00%    
Under Age 65 [Member] | OPEB [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Health care cost trend rate assumed for next fiscal year 7.00% 7.25%  
Under Age 65 [Member] | OPEB [Member] | Consumers Energy Company [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Health care cost trend rate assumed for next fiscal year 7.00% 7.25%  
Over Age 65 [Member] | OPEB [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Health care cost trend rate assumed for next fiscal year 7.75% 8.00%  
Over Age 65 [Member] | OPEB [Member] | Consumers Energy Company [Member]      
Defined Benefit Plan Disclosure [Line Items]      
Health care cost trend rate assumed for next fiscal year 7.75% 8.00%